Also in my electorate, which I know the member for Kingston did not visit, was a function on Friday night for the Manning Memorial Bowling Club. I know many people in the audience here probably participate in bowls. It is one of the most participated in sports in Australia. It was their presentation night. It was a night for all their awards. There were about 60 people there.

I would like to congratulate particularly the women's team of the Manning Memorial Bowling Club because, out of the 12 participants who made the WA state team, seven of them came from the Manning Memorial Bowling Club. As you can see, they were not only well represented; they were overrepresented. That obviously indicates the strong women's team they have at the Manning Memorial Bowling Club.

I would also like to congratulate Graham and Laura, who were nominated the men's and women's bowlers of the year of the club. I also congratulate Faye Doran, who was there. She is the patron of the club and has been an institution at the Manning Memorial Bowling Club for many years. I hope to see her around at the bowls club for many years to come.
